What to Do at the Blue Hole

The Blue Hole Ocho Rios Jamaica offers a variety of activities that make it a perfect day trip. Here’s what you can look forward to:

1. Swim in the Turquoise Pools

Take a dip in the cool, refreshing water of the natural pools. Surrounded by lush greenery, the pools are perfect for swimming or simply floating while enjoying the peaceful sounds of nature.

2. Try Cliff Jumping

For thrill-seekers, the Blue Hole has multiple cliff-jumping spots! With jumps ranging from beginner-friendly to more challenging heights, you can test your courage and make a big splash. The guides are always there to show you the best (and safest) jumping spots.

3. Rope Swing Into the Water

Add some fun to your visit with the rope swing! Feel like Tarzan as you swing out over the water and let go for an exhilarating plunge into the sparkling blue pool below.

4. Explore the Waterfalls

The Blue Hole’s cascading waterfalls are perfect for climbing and exploring. With the help of your guide, you can scale the rocks and discover hidden spots, making it feel like your very own jungle adventure.

Tips for Visiting the Blue Hole

To make sure you have the best possible experience at the Blue Hole Ocho Rios Jamaica, here are a few helpful tips:

  1. Wear Water Shoes
    The rocks around the waterfalls and pools can be slippery, so water shoes are highly recommended for safety and comfort.
  2. Bring a Swimsuit and Towel
    You’ll definitely want to take a dip in the water, so make sure you’re dressed for the occasion!
  3. Travel Light
    Pack light and bring only the essentials—swimsuit, towel, sunscreen, and a waterproof bag for your valuables.
  4. Hire a Guide
    Local guides are available to help you navigate the area, show you the best spots for jumping and swimming, and ensure your safety. They are knowledgeable, friendly, and will enhance your experience.
  5. Bring Cash
    There’s typically an entrance fee to access the Blue Hole, and you may also want to tip your guide or purchase snacks and souvenirs.

How to Get to the Blue Hole

The Blue Hole Ocho Rios Jamaica is located about 20–30 minutes from Ocho Rios and approximately 1.5 hours from Montego Bay. The easiest way to get there is by booking a tour or hiring a private driver.Many guided tours include transportation, entrance fees, and even stops at other nearby attractions like Dunn’s River Falls or the White River. If you’re staying at a resort, the concierge can help you arrange transportation.
